核心文件夹:
tomcat-8.0.35-search------端口8888
solr-7.2.0------端口8984
核心配置:
用于配置solr索引的定时增量更新和全部更新,两个文件保持一致就可以。
/tomcat/tomcat-8.0.35-search/bin/solr/conf/dataimport.properties
/solr-7.2.0/server/solr/chuai/conf/dataimport.properties
用于配置数据源,和字段对应,单开的solr的数据库账号,权限只有一个待搜索的表
/solr-7.2.0/server/solr/chuai/conf/data-config.xml
solr日常配置,是否索引,自动同步索引等
/solr-7.2.0/server/solr/chuai/conf/solrconfig.xml
/solr-7.2.0/server/solr/chuai/conf/schema.xml
注意:
自动同步索引 用的是dataimport scheduler的jar包。
部署需要将search-chuai的项目maven打包,放到/tomcat/tomcat-8.0.35-search/webapps
记得项目目录下的 solr.url的端口 WEB-INF/spring/properties/product.properties
应先启动solr,在启动tomcat。
启动脚本:
./solr-7.2.0/bin/solr start -p 8984 -force
./tomcat/tomcat-8.0.35-search/bin/startup.sh